Thanks to 2K Games for the review code. Borderlands is a series near and dear to my heart as I've met some very close friends through it. Suffice to say that Tiny Tina's Wonderlands was a game I was really looking forward to after a disappointing run in Borderlands 3. The fantasy-like D&D refresh seemed to be exactly what they needed on paper as it would undoubtedly shake up the game systems. However, much of this more of the same with problems from previous entries only being exacerbated. All in all, Tiny Tina's Wonderlands left me super disappointed.
